Timothy Jarvis

Timothy Jarvis began his career as a financial advisor after earning a Bachelor of Business Administration in Business Management from Ohio University. For years, he guided clients through complex financial decisions, but a personal experience reshaped his professional journey. When his grandmother was diagnosed with Alzheimer’s, Timothy faced the challenges of navigating a confusing and often frustrating system to secure her care. This life-changing experience led him to discover the field of elder law, igniting a passion to help others in similar situations.
Timothy pursued his Juris Doctorate at Northern Kentucky University’s Salmon P. Chase College of Law, pivoting his career toward elder law and estate planning. In 2003, he founded the Jarvis Law Office, which is dedicated to helping older adults and their families plan for the future and manage long-term healthcare crises. His approach integrates legal, financial, and emotional support, with a focus on honoring clients’ wishes in all aspects of estate planning.
Under Timothy’s leadership, the Jarvis Law Office has expanded to three locations with a team of over 35 professionals. As the firm’s founder and owner, he oversees all critical aspects of its operations, including marketing, sales, production, personnel, and finances, while driving the strategic vision for its continued growth.
